brundlefly
Possibly a MIDI buffering issue because LP-64 introduces PDC? Try setting your MIDI Prepare Using buffer up to 500ms if it's not there already.
 
And/or do you have any MIDI FX in the project (not just on that track)? They can also introduce some buffering issues.
